Construction Project Coordinator

We have an immediate opportunity for a Construction Project Coordinator who will be responsible for assisting in the day-to-day procurement of materials, equipment, and services that support our construction projects from project kickoff through final close-out. Work hours are Monday through Friday 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.

Job Responsibilities:
  • Issue, track, and expedite purchase orders for structures, glazing, environmental control systems, irrigation components, benching, fasteners, and related construction materials
  • Verify quantities, pricing, lead times, delivery terms, and specifications against project requirements and approved budgets before issuing each purchase order
  • Solicit and compare vendor quotations for routine purchases and maintain accurate purchase order records, vendor confirmations, and shipping documentation
  • Reconcile vendor invoices against purchase orders and packing slips; resolve pricing or quantity discrepancies before approval
  • Work directly with Program Managers to understand site schedules, sequencing requirements, and delivery windows for each active project
  • Coordinate delivery of materials and equipment to job sites, staging yards, and the Strongsville depot to align with crew arrivals and installation milestones
  • Communicate proactively with Program Managers, Superintendents, and field crews regarding order status, ETA changes, backorders, and substitutions
  • Arrange freight, trucking, and specialized transportation, confirm site readiness for receipt, and track equipment rentals, returns, and on-site tool needs in coordination with field leadership
  • Maintain working relationships with established suppliers, manufacturers, fabricators, and distributors serving the construction industry
  • Follow up on open orders and expedite shipments when schedules tighten
  • Document vendor performance issues such as late deliveries, short shipments, damaged goods, or quality defects, process returns, warranty claims, and credit memos in coordination with vendors and accounting
  • Monitor stock levels of commonly used materials, consumables, and hardware at the shop and depot, place replenishment orders to maintain adequate inventory without overstocking
  • Support periodic physical inventory counts and reconciliation and help track company-owned tools and equipment assigned to crews and job sites
  • Generate routine reports covering open purchase orders, committed costs, receipt status, and delivery schedules
